Why Ross homes need off-track & cable done right

In Ross cables tend to fail from the slow rust that damp creekside nights leave behind, and oak debris packed into a track can nudge a roller off its path until the door binds and jumps. On a heavy detached-garage door that off-track weight can drop or damage the door, and forcing the opener only bends the track and snaps the second cable. We replace cables in pairs, clear and straighten the tracks, swap any rusted or bent hardware, and set the door back true so it travels centered instead of grinding on a swollen frame.

When a lift cable frays or a roller jumps the track, the door hangs crooked, binds, or can drop unexpectedly — a genuine safety hazard, especially on a heavy door. Don't force the opener, which compounds the damage. We safely secure the door, replace cables, rollers and any bent hardware, re-rail it on the tracks, and re-balance the whole system.

Signs you need off-track & cable

  • Door is crooked or hanging out of the tracks
  • A cable is dangling, frayed, or snapped
  • Door binds, jams, or grinds against the frame
  • Loud snap followed by the door dropping on one side
  • Rollers popped out of the track

What to expect on your Ross visit

  1. 1

    Secure the door safely

    An off-track door can fall. We first stabilize and support it, and disengage the opener so no one forces it and makes the damage worse.

  2. 2

    Replace the failed hardware

    We install new cables (always in pairs), fresh rollers, and straighten or replace any bent brackets, hinges or track sections.

  3. 3

    Re-rail & re-align

    The door goes back onto true, plumb tracks with correct spacing, so it travels centered without rubbing or binding.

  4. 4

    Balance & safety test

    We re-check spring balance and safety cables, then cycle the door repeatedly to confirm smooth, level, quiet travel.

Off-Track & Cable in Ross — FAQs

My Ross garage door is hanging crooked — what should I do?

Stop using it and switch the opener off at the wall. A crooked door can come down, and forcing the motor just bends the track and breaks more hardware. Phone us and we'll support and secure it before anything else, usually the same hour.

Could oak debris really knock my door off its track?

It contributes. Acorns and packed leaf litter in the bottom track can push a roller off line, and once the door binds it's more likely to jump, especially if a rusted cable is already fraying. We clear the tracks and fix the root cause so it doesn't recur.

Is it safe to use my garage door if it's off track?

No — please stop using it. An off-track or crooked door can fall or jam, and running the opener against it can bend tracks and snap more cables. Disconnect the opener and call us.

Why did my garage door come off its track?

Common causes are a broken or worn roller, a snapped lift cable, a minor impact (a bumper or basketball hoop), or loose track brackets. We fix the root cause, not just the symptom, so it doesn't recur.

Do cables always need to be replaced in pairs?

We replace them in pairs because both cables share the same wear and cycle life. Replacing only one leaves an imbalance and usually a second failure soon after.

Can you fix a bent track, or does it need a whole new door?

Minor track damage can often be straightened or the affected section replaced. We'll tell you honestly if the tracks are salvageable or whether replacement is the safer, longer-lasting fix.
